When comparing trading costs for Thailand traders, spreads and commissions are the primary factors. OctaFX offers a Razor account with spreads from 0.0 pips and a commission of $3 per lot per side, making it ideal for scalpers and high-frequency traders. Admirals provides a Zero account with spreads from 0.5 pips and a commission of $3 per lot, which is slightly higher. For standard account users, Admirals has spreads from 0.8 pips with no commission, while OctaFX offers spreads from 0.5 pips with no commission. Over 100 trades per month, OctaFX can save Thai traders 10-20% on costs, especially on major pairs like EUR/USD and USD/JPY. However, Admirals includes access to stocks and ETFs, which may offset higher forex costs for diversified portfolios.

Both brokers offer MetaTrader 4 and MetaTrader 5, which are the gold standards for Thai traders. Admirals also provides its proprietary WebTrader and mobile apps, which include advanced charting tools and risk management features. OctaFX focuses on simplicity with a user-friendly mobile app that supports one-click trading and social trading features. For Thai traders who need advanced analysis and automated trading, Admirals is stronger. For those who prefer a streamlined, mobile-first experience with copy trading, OctaFX is more suitable. Both platforms are available in Thai language, but OctaFX's interface is more intuitive for beginners.

Regulation is a key concern for Thailand traders, as neither broker is regulated by the SEC Thailand. Admirals is regulated by top-tier authorities including the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), and ASIC (Australia), offering strong client fund segregation and negative balance protection. OctaFX is regulated by the FSA (St. Vincent and the Grenadines) and has a license from the CySEC (for EU clients), but its offshore regulation provides less investor protection. For Thai traders prioritizing safety, Admirals is the more secure choice. However, OctaFX's lack of strict regulation allows it to offer higher leverage (up to 1:500) and lower minimum deposits, which some experienced traders may prefer. Always verify the broker's current regulatory status before depositing.

Depositing and withdrawing funds is seamless for Thailand traders with both brokers, but OctaFX has an edge with local payment support. OctaFX accepts PromptPay (instant transfers), Thai Bank Transfer (via local banks like Bangkok Bank, Kasikorn), and Skrill, with no deposit fees and instant processing. Minimum deposit is just $10. Admirals supports Bank Transfer (THB) and Skrill, but not PromptPay, and requires a minimum deposit of $100. Withdrawals at OctaFX are processed within 24 hours for e-wallets and 1-3 business days for bank transfers. Admirals takes 1-2 days for e-wallets and 3-5 days for bank transfers. For Thai traders who value speed and convenience, OctaFX's PromptPay integration is a significant advantage. Both brokers do not charge deposit fees, but check for any intermediary bank fees for THB transfers.

For Muslim traders in Thailand, both Admirals and OctaFX off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ts that comply with Sharia law by not charging or paying overnight interest. Admirals provides Islamic accounts upon request for eligible clients, but may have a limited number of instruments available. OctaFX offers swap-free accounts automatically for all traders without any additional fees or restrictions, making it more inclusive. OctaFX also does not charge a fee for maintaining the Islamic account, whereas Admirals may apply a small administrative fee after a certain period. For Thai Muslim traders seeking hassle-free Sharia-compliant trading, OctaFX is the better option.
